Feature Summary
•
Intel Agilex I-Series (AGIB027) device in the 2957A BGA package
— 0.8 VID-adjustable VCC core
— R-tile transceivers supporting PCIe Gen5/CXL
— F-tile transceivers supporting 56 Gbps NRZ
•
FPGA configuration
— Partial reconfiguration support
— Configuration via Protocol (CvP) configuration support
— 2 Gb QSPI flash
— Storage for two configuration images in flash (factory and user)
— JTAG header for device programming
— Built-in Intel FPGA Download Cable II for device programming
•
Programmable clock sources
— 156.25 MHz differential LVDS for F-tile (QSFPDD)
— 100.000 MHz HCSL for PCIe and CXL (R-tile)
— 33.33 MHz differential LVDS for memory
— 125 MHz configuration clock
— 100 MHz differential LVDS for I/O banks
